Chicken Quesadilla

Chicken Quesadilla is a delicious Mexican dish featuring tortillas filled with seasoned chicken and cheese, grilled to perfection. It makes for a quick lunch or dinner option, loaded with flavor and very satisfying.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ine Mexican
Servings 4 People
Calories 350 kcal

Equipment

  • 1 skillet or frying pan
  • 1 spatula
  • 1 cutting board
  • 1 bowl
  • 1 set measuring cups and spoons

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ded Ensure the cooked chicken is well-seasoned for the best flavor.
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ese
  • 1/2 cup bell pepper, diced
  • 1/2 cup onion, diced
  • 1 teaspoon taco seasoning
  • 4 large flour tortillas
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• salsa for serving optional
  • sour cream for serving optional

Instructions
 

  • In a bowl, combine the shredded chicken, diced bell pepper, diced onion, and taco seasoning. Mix until well combined.
  •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  • Place one tortilla in the skillet. Sprinkle half of the cheddar and Monterey Jack cheese on one half of the tortilla.
  • Layer half of the chicken mixture over the cheese, then top with more cheese.
  • Fold the tortilla in half to cover the filling and press gently to seal.
  • Cook for about 3-4 minutes, or until the bottom is golden brown and the cheese starts to melt. Flip the quesadilla carefully with a spatula and cook for another 3-4 minutes on the other side.
  • Remove the quesadilla from the skillet and repeat the process for the remaining tortillas and filling.
  • Cut each quesadilla into wedges and serve warm with salsa and sour cream if desired.

Notes

Ensure the cooked chicken is well-seasoned for the best flavor.
You can customize the filling by adding vegetables like spinach or mushrooms, or substituting the chicken with beef or beans for a different option.
Store any leftover quesadillas in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at in a skillet before serving.
